Summary
- Creators:
- Stachnik, Tadeusz, 1927-
- Abstract:
- Pamphlets, serial issues, bulletins, newsletters, leaflets, flyers, memoranda, reports, identification papers, and photographs, relating to political and human rights conditions in Poland, dissent from the communist regime, and the growth of Solidarnosc and other opposition movements.
- Extent:
- 8 manuscript boxes (3.2 Linear Feet)
- Language:
- Polish
